(1924)

Is this the most attractive car of the B&M era? Well I'd like to think that this pretty Boat Tail car with 11 hp side valve engine is a real contender. According to the AM Regsiter, this car started life as a Works track racer which following a crash, donated parts to make this car. It is now owned by Aston Martin themselves and is often displayed at the factory in Gaydon. It was also displayed as part of the 100 timeline for the Aston Martin Centenary at Kensington Palace in July 2013.
